- ### remove-block-children?
- When this setting is true, do not return child blocks separately when they are already shown as a sub-bullet of a parent block.
- When this setting is false, the parent block is returned including all its children as well as the child blocks individually when they also match the query criteria.
- This only applies when the property group-by-page? is set to false.
- Only applies to queries that return blocks.
